1 Why did BitMines stock go down if they just bought 73 million worth of Ethereum
Buying a large amount of Ethereum doesnt automatically make a companys stock go up Investors might have been worried about why they spent so much cash or they might have sold the stock because they saw the move as risky or a sign of other problems
2 Isnt buying Ethereum a good thing Doesnt that mean the company is growing
Not always While it shows the company is investing in crypto it also uses up a lot of cash If investors think the company should have used that money to pay down debt buy back its own stock or fund core operations they might sell causing the price to drop
3 Does this mean BitMine is in trouble
Not necessarily It could mean they are very bullish on Ethereum However a stock drop often signals that the market disagrees with the companys strategy or sees a red flag
4 I thought crypto companies go up when they buy crypto What gives
Thats a common myth Sometimes the market reacts negatively if the purchase seems desperate poorly timed or if the company overpays The stock price reflects all news and sentiment not just the headline

5 Could the drop be because investors are worried about the price BitMine paid for Ethereum
Yes If BitMine bought Ethereum near a local high investors might fear a loss if the price falls The market often punishes companies for buying assets at what traders consider a top
6 Is it possible the stock dropped because the market thinks BitMine is becoming a crypto fund instead of a mining company
Exactly Many investors bought BitMine stock because they wanted exposure to mining not to speculating on Ethereums price If the company hoards crypto instead of selling it for profit it changes the business model which can scare away traditional investors
